Transaction 8ecb39be6096f79bb30d6522be6c9c5256917934842d7aad56f9a436e1019490
1 Input
1 Output
-
8ecb39be6096f79bb30d6522be6c9c5256917934842d7aad56f9a436e1019490:0
- value
- 755186
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5a336edd3b9e6f9489bec8d0ff542adf602789ed OP_EQUAL
- address
- 39uxMSVgGyt5EKXFAvb6kbw18j2BTWgHwz